North Carolina reports 952 COVID-19 cases since Tuesday; Local areas see three of state's 30 additional deaths

The North Carolina Department of Health and Human Services released their daily update involving COVID-19 cases within the state.

As of Wednesday, there are now 196,501 cases, 912 people hospitalized and 3,316 COVID-19 related deaths.

That is 952 new cases, seven additional hospitalizations and 30 additional deaths from Tuesday.

A total of 2,842,427 total COVID-19 tests have been completed in North Carolina.
